The two-stage gasifier is a high-efficiency coal gasification equipment. Its basic structure mainly consists of two parts: a retort section and a gasification section.
The carbonization section is located in the upper part of the furnace body. Its main function is to dry and low-temperature carbonization of the coal entering the furnace. During this process, volatile matter in the coal gradually precipitates, forming retort gas. This part of the gas is rich in tar and is the main component of the top gas.
The gasification section is located at the lower part of the furnace body. Its main task is to react the semi-charred coal after carbonization with the gasification agent (such as air, steam) to generate gasification gas. Gasification gas is mainly composed of combustible gases such as carbon monoxide and hydrogen. It has a relatively high temperature and is the main source of bottom gas.

Two-stage gas generatorIt is also equipped with auxiliary systems such as coal preparation, coal addition, ash removal and gasification agent preparation to ensure the smooth progress of the entire coal gasification process. These systems work together to enable this equipment to efficiently and stably produce gas that meets the requirements.
